Lamar Library celebrates the Year of the Dog

The Lamar Library brought a touch of the far east to local kids at a February 17 tea party, where young men and ladies watched the Disney classic “Mulan,” heard a very informative and entertaining story about etiquette (read by children’s librarian Kelly Shull), enjoyed some Chinese treats and cuisine, and learned about the Chinese Zodiac signs – including which of 12 cool animals signifies their birth year.

Shull said the Lamar Library tries to have a different themed tea party every year around Valentine’s Day, allowing toddlers to sixth graders to dress fancy (if they wish), share some delicious food, and get a little practice on their table manners and socialization. Shull says the tea parties also serve as a reminder that the library isn’t just for checking out books – it’s a fun place that offers lots of paths to learning.
